This blog category is dedicated to raising awareness about the signs, impact, and realities of physical abuse. It explores how abuse often escalates over time, beginning with smaller acts of aggression or intimidation before becoming more severe. Many people experiencing physical abuse may feel fear, confusion, shame, or difficulty recognizing their situation due to emotional manipulation or cycles of apology and escalation

Verbal and emotional abuse can be just as damaging as physical violence, yet it is often overlooked or minimized. Because there are no visible injuries, many victims question whether what they are experiencing is truly abuse. The truth is that words and emotional manipulation can leave deep, lasting scars.
